Logistics Distribution Analyst

The Logistics Distribution Analyst supports the coordination of domestic logistics to help ensure products to the OE and Aftermarket customers are deliv-ered on time. The role involves assisting with the scheduling and monitoring of shipments from Timken de Mexico to customers, following up with transportation providers to balance cost, service, and quality of deliveries.

It also includes tracking and reporting on basic KPIs related to delivery performance, as well as supporting the verifica-tion of vendor invoices and payments according to established rates.

Additionally, the position collaborates in identifying opportunities for improvement with transportation suppliers.

As a Logistics Distribution Analyst you will:

  • Coordinate with 3PL providers for transportation services, including pick-ups and deliveries of materials.
  • Request and follow up on transportation services to support on-time execution.
  • Record and report KPIs related to delivery performance on a monthly basis.
  • Gather and organize information to support vendor payment processes according to approved tariffs, using available systems.
  • Review invoices for completed services and request corrections when needed.
  • Follow up with transportation companies on claims when incidents occur.
  • Keep updated records of freight rates.
  • Collect and review information on transportation activities to identify basic issues or improvement opportunities.
  • Maintain effective communication with suppliers to support agreements and service conditions.
  • Assist in monitoring logistics expenses within the approved budget.
  • Support the registration of goods receipt processes in SAP for indirect products and services.
  • Support end users in clarifying doubts regarding travel applications and expense reports when needed.

About The Timken Company

The Timken Company (NYSE: TKR), a global technology leader in engineered bearings and industrial motion, designs a growing portfolio of next-generation products for diverse industries. For 125 years, Timken has used its specialized expertise to innovate and create customer-centric solutions that increase reliability and efficiency. The company posted $4.8 billion in sales in 2023 and employs more than 19,000 people globally, operating from 45 countries.
